Christmas Eve shock: Slippery roads lead to several accidents in Schrobenhausen!
Winter road conditions and the anticipation of Christmas caused some unpleasant surprises in the Schrobenhausen region on Christmas Eve. Several traffic accidents occurred due to the slippery state roads like the Danube Courier reported. In the accidents that were caused by improper speed on slippery roads, there was a total of one person injured and significant property damage.
At around 8 p.m., a 26-year-old driver from Schrobenhausen lost control of his vehicle in a left-hand bend on state road 2050 between Aresing and Schrobenhausen. His car overturned and then ended up on its roof. The driver was taken to hospital with minor injuries while the vehicle had to be towed.
More accidents and hit-and-runs
But the incidents did not end there. While the police were busy investigating the accident, officers discovered another accident at the same location: an unknown vehicle had left State Road 2046 between 6 p.m. and 9:30 p.m., crossed State Road 2044 and ended up in an adjacent field, damaging a sign and the field. However, the driver left unrecognized in the direction of Edelshausen. The police are asking witnesses to call (08252)89750.
